Etymology edit

From τρι- (tri-, three) +‎ σκέλος (skélos, leg) +‎ -ής (-ḗs, adjective suffix).

Adjective edit

τρισκελής (triskelḗsm or f (neuter τρισκελές); third declension

  1. Having three spirals, or three bent human legs.
